Fidia In Webster's Dictionary

\Fid"i*a\, n. [NL., prob. fr. L. fidus trusty.] (Zo["o]l.) A genus of small beetles, of which one species (the grapevine Fidia, {F. longipes}) is very injurious to vines in America.
